What Is Low-Level Safe Laser Therapy (Lllt), Help Ulcerative Wounds?
Safe Laser Low Level Laser Therapy (LLLT) can be utilized to treat wounds that are ulcerative in several ways. It stimulates the fibroblast, collagen, and angiogenesis processes (formation of blood vessels) which are all important in healing of wounds. This can be used to aid in the speedy healing of ulcerative injuries.
LLLT can reduce inflammation by inhibiting the release proinflammatory cytokines. It also enhances the production of anti-inflammatory mediators. In the case of ulcerative wounds in which inflammation may impede healing and cause tissue damage, LLLT can help reduce inflammation and create a more favorable environment to heal.
Pain Relief - LLLT reduces the discomfort through reducing nerve conduction. It may also assist to relieve discomfort from ulcerative sores, which can lead to severe pain.
Improved Circulation LLLT increases vasodilation, microcirculation and blood flow. Increased circulation brings oxygen and nutrients into the tissues. This promotes healing and aids in the elimination of toxins and waste.
Antimicrobial effects - LLLT was shown to possess antimicrobial properties which can lower the chance of infection in ulcerative lesions. LLLT helps to clear bacterial waste, which can reduce the risk of infection in wounds.
Reduced Scar formation Reduction of Scar Formation LLLT can help minimize scarring from ulcers by encouraging tissue remodeling and regeneration. LLLT boosts collagen production and aligns collagen bundles in order to create a stronger, more organized scar. This results in better aesthetic results.
In general, low-level Laser treatment with Safe Laser aids in faster healing with less pain, and better outcomes for wounds. However, it is essential to speak with a healthcare professional for proper wound care and treatment recommendations before using LLLT for ulcerative wounds. What Is The Safe Low-Level Laser Treatment (Lllt) For Throat Problems?
Low-level laser therapy, which is safe and secure (LLLT), can help with a variety of throat issues. LLLT could help to reduce swelling and discomfort in cases such as pharyngitis or tonsillitis.
Pain Relief- LLLT alters the perception of pain by affecting nerve conduction and decreasing the release of pain mediators such as substance P. For conditions like throat irritation or sore throat, LLLT can help alleviate pain and discomfort, providing relief for individuals experiencing throat-related pain.
Enhanced Tissue Healing - LLLT stimulates tissue regeneration and repair by stimulating the cellular metabolism. LLLT helps promote faster healing in conditions such as injuries to the vocal cord or throat ulcers. This reduces the risk of complications and improving the overall health of the throat.
LLLT improves blood circulation LLLT promotes microcirculation by increasing vasodilation. This improves the flow of blood to tissues in the throat. Improved circulation can deliver oxygen and nutrients directly to inflamed tissues and decrease inflammation.
LLLT can help reduce swelling of the throat tissues by promoting lymphatic drainage. This is particularly beneficial for individuals with conditions like laryngitis and post-operative throat swelling.
Management of Voice Disorders LLLT can aid in improving the quality of your voice and help reduce the symptoms of hoarseness, vocal fatigue or. Through promoting healing of tissues and reducing inflammation within the vocal cords, LLLT helps to restore vocal function and reduce voice-related symptoms.
Secure Laser low-level therapy provides an uninvasive, drug-free treatment to a variety of throat problems, reducing symptoms such as pain, inflammation, and difficulties in swallowing. Consult a doctor for a diagnosis and for recommendations for treatment prior to using LLLT. How Long Before A Safe Laser Device Will Have An Effect On Healing Of Wounds?
Safe Laser low-level Laser Therapy (LLLT), can help heal wounds. The results are dependent on several factors including the severity, type and health of a person and their response to treatment. Typically, a sequence of LLLT over a set time is suggested to ensure optimal healing of wounds.
Type and Severity- The severity and type of the wound will determine the amount of LLLT sessions required. In certain instances, smaller and less severe wounds need fewer sessions than larger or more severe wounds. Additionally, chronic injuries or those that have an underlying health issue may require additional sessions in order to ensure optimal wound healing.
The wound healing phase can also affect the number of LLLT sessions required. Treatment can differ based on the stage of wound healing. LLLT is highly effective in every stage of healing promoting the repair of tissues and regenerative processes.
Individual Response to Treatment Personal factors, such as overall health immune function, healing ability, can affect the way that a person responds to LLLT to treat wounds. Some individuals will respond more quickly to treatment and experience an earlier healing process for wounds, while other may require a more prolonged course of treatment.
Treatment Protocol - The treatment plan that is recommended by a medical expert will establish the frequency and duration of LLLT sessions required to heal injuries. Healthcare providers can tailor the treatment plan to meet the needs of the individual's needs, and can plan LLLT every week or at specific intervals.
Some patients may notice improvements in their wounds after a couple of LLLT treatments, whereas others may require more comprehensive treatment to get optimal results. It's crucial to follow the prescribed treatment regimen set by a medical professional and to attend all scheduled LLLT sessions to reap the maximum effects of the therapy on wound healing. To ensure the best possible treatment of your wound, you must also keep in contact with your health professional.
